Grigor Dimitrov Reaches New Ranking High
Bulgaria’s Grigor Dimitrov has reached a record high 15th place in the tennis ATP world rankings.
The 22-year-old youngster from Haskovo moves one spot above his previous 16th place, following the tournaments in Indian Wells and Miami.

Bulgaria’s Dimitrov Keeps 16th Position Ahead of Miami Masters
Bulgaria's tennis star Grigor Dimitrov keeps his 16th position in the ATP world rankings, ahead of the Miami tournament.
Dimitrov reached the 3rd round of the Indian Wells last week, which was the same performance as last year, meaning he defended his 45 points for the ranking.
Bulgaria’s Pironkova Suffers 1st Round Loss in Indian Wells
Bulgaria's Tsvetana Pironkova suffered a rough defeat in the first round of the tennis tournament in Indian Wells.
Pironkova lost 2:6, 1:6 to USA's Madison Keys in a match which lasted only 53 minutes. This was the first meeting between the two players.
Keys will face Italian Roberta Vinci in the second round.
Grigor Dimitrov Drops In the Rankings, Tsvetana Pironkova Rises
Bulgaria's tennis player Grigor Dimitrov slipped two positions in the rankings and is now 22-nd, with 1657 points.
Dimitrov is preparing for the tournament in Acapulco where he will face the Australian Marinko Matosevic, with whom he hasn't played before.
